kingarthur
12.05.2011, 13:04:42
Hi Leute, ich habe eine costumwaffe gemodelt und würde sie gerne in HL2 integrieren.
Ich wollte das SMG1 ersetzten doch im Spiel wird es nicht dargestellt, oder so dargestellt, dass es nicht in meinem blickwinkel ist.
Im modelviewer wird die waffe samt animation angezeigt und korrekt ausgeführt. Kann mir jemand sagen woran es liegen könnte?
Meine QC:
$modelname "weapons/v_smg1.mdl"
$body "studio" "Smg1_reference.smd"
$cdmaterials "models\Weapons\V_hand\"
$cdmaterials "models\weapons\k98\"
// Model uses material "v_hand_sheet.vmt"
// Model uses material "texture5.vmt"
// Model uses material "texture4.vmt"
// Model uses material "v_smg1_sheet.vmt"
//$attachment "muzzle" "ValveBiped.muzzle" 0.00 -0.00 -0.00 rotate 0.00 -0.00 0.00
//$attachment "1" "ValveBiped.eject" -0.00 -0.00 0.00 rotate 0.00 0.00 0.00
$surfaceprop "default"
$sequence idle01 "idle01" loop ACT_VM_IDLE 1 fps 30.00 node Ready
$sequence fire01 "fire01" ACT_VM_PRIMARYATTACK 1 fps 30.00 node Fire {
{ event AE_MUZZLEFLASH 0 "SMG1 MUZZLE" }
{ event 6001 0 "0" }
}
$sequence fire02 "fire02" ACT_VM_RECOIL1 1 fps 30.00 node Fire {
{ event AE_MUZZLEFLASH 0 "SMG1 MUZZLE" }
{ event 6001 0 "0" }
}
$sequence fire03 "fire03" ACT_VM_RECOIL2 1 fps 30.00 node Fire {
{ event AE_MUZZLEFLASH 0 "SMG1 MUZZLE" }
{ event 6001 0 "0" }
}
$sequence fire04 "fire04" ACT_VM_RECOIL3 1 fps 30.00 node Fire {
{ event AE_MUZZLEFLASH 0 "SMG1 MUZZLE" }
{ event 6001 0 "0" }
}
$sequence altfire "altfire" ACT_VM_SECONDARYATTACK 1 fps 30.00 node Fire
$sequence draw "draw" ACT_VM_DRAW 1 fps 30.00 node Ready
$sequence reload "reload" ACT_VM_RELOAD 1 fps 30.00 node Ready
$sequence dryfire "dryfire" ACT_VM_DRYFIRE 1 fps 30.00 node Fire
$sequence idletolow "idletolow" ACT_VM_LOWERED_TO_IDLE 1 fps 30.00 transition Ready Low
$sequence lowtoidle "lowtoidle" ACT_VM_IDLE_TO_LOWERED 1 fps 30.00 transition Low Ready
$sequence lowidle "lowidle" loop ACT_VM_IDLE_LOWERED 1 fps 30.00 node Low
E:
hat sich geklärt ^^ die Z achsen der modelprogramme sind überall anders :P
Ich wollte das SMG1 ersetzten doch im Spiel wird es nicht dargestellt, oder so dargestellt, dass es nicht in meinem blickwinkel ist.
Im modelviewer wird die waffe samt animation angezeigt und korrekt ausgeführt. Kann mir jemand sagen woran es liegen könnte?
Meine QC:
$modelname "weapons/v_smg1.mdl"
$body "studio" "Smg1_reference.smd"
$cdmaterials "models\Weapons\V_hand\"
$cdmaterials "models\weapons\k98\"
// Model uses material "v_hand_sheet.vmt"
// Model uses material "texture5.vmt"
// Model uses material "texture4.vmt"
// Model uses material "v_smg1_sheet.vmt"
//$attachment "muzzle" "ValveBiped.muzzle" 0.00 -0.00 -0.00 rotate 0.00 -0.00 0.00
//$attachment "1" "ValveBiped.eject" -0.00 -0.00 0.00 rotate 0.00 0.00 0.00
$surfaceprop "default"
$sequence idle01 "idle01" loop ACT_VM_IDLE 1 fps 30.00 node Ready
$sequence fire01 "fire01" ACT_VM_PRIMARYATTACK 1 fps 30.00 node Fire {
{ event AE_MUZZLEFLASH 0 "SMG1 MUZZLE" }
{ event 6001 0 "0" }
}
$sequence fire02 "fire02" ACT_VM_RECOIL1 1 fps 30.00 node Fire {
{ event AE_MUZZLEFLASH 0 "SMG1 MUZZLE" }
{ event 6001 0 "0" }
}
$sequence fire03 "fire03" ACT_VM_RECOIL2 1 fps 30.00 node Fire {
{ event AE_MUZZLEFLASH 0 "SMG1 MUZZLE" }
{ event 6001 0 "0" }
}
$sequence fire04 "fire04" ACT_VM_RECOIL3 1 fps 30.00 node Fire {
{ event AE_MUZZLEFLASH 0 "SMG1 MUZZLE" }
{ event 6001 0 "0" }
}
$sequence altfire "altfire" ACT_VM_SECONDARYATTACK 1 fps 30.00 node Fire
$sequence draw "draw" ACT_VM_DRAW 1 fps 30.00 node Ready
$sequence reload "reload" ACT_VM_RELOAD 1 fps 30.00 node Ready
$sequence dryfire "dryfire" ACT_VM_DRYFIRE 1 fps 30.00 node Fire
$sequence idletolow "idletolow" ACT_VM_LOWERED_TO_IDLE 1 fps 30.00 transition Ready Low
$sequence lowtoidle "lowtoidle" ACT_VM_IDLE_TO_LOWERED 1 fps 30.00 transition Low Ready
$sequence lowidle "lowidle" loop ACT_VM_IDLE_LOWERED 1 fps 30.00 node Low
E:
hat sich geklärt ^^ die Z achsen der modelprogramme sind überall anders :P